Security updates available for Adobe Connect | APSB18-18
+-----------------------------------------------------------------------------+
|Bulletin ID              |Date Published                  |Priority          |
|-------------------------+--------------------------------+------------------|
|APSB18-18                |May 8, 2018                     |2                 |
+-----------------------------------------------------------------------------+

Summary

An important authentication bypass vulnerability (CVE-2018-4994) exists in
Adobe Connect versions 9.7.5 and earlier. Successful exploitation of this
vulnerability could result in sensitive information disclosure.

A mitigation is available to customers by modifying Tomcat filters to control
remote access to system configuration files. Please refer to the following 
help page for more details. An upcoming release of version 9.8.1 will include
this change in default deployments.
